Bomb And Shooting Threats Sent To Forest Hills High School: Cops
A Forest Hills High School employee received an email threatening to bomb and shoot up the school. Officials say it isn't credible.

FOREST HILLS, QUEENS — A Forest Hills High School employee received an anonymous email Sunday threatening to bomb and shoot up the school, but city officials say the threat isn't credible.
Sent about 8 p.m., the email said the attack would take place on a Tuesday, police said.
The sender threatened to target the school's minority students, the Forest Hills Post reported.

Reached by phone, an administrator in the school's main office said the school was open Monday and students are safe.
The threat was deemed not credible, according to Department of Education spokesperson Miranda Barbot.
